Local SEO: How to Dominate Your Region

For businesses operating in specific regions, developing local SEO is essential:

  • Optimize your Google Business Profile

  • Register in local directories

  • Actively collect customer reviews

These actions significantly boost your business’s search visibility within a specific geographic location.

Technical SEO Optimization

 

Mobile-Friendly Design

Today, over 70% of users access websites from mobile devices. Therefore, having a mobile-friendly website is one of the most critical factors for SEO success.

 

Page Loading Speed

Websites that take longer than three seconds to load lose up to half of their visitors. Fast page loading not only improves user experience but also positively impacts search engine rankings.

 

Website Architecture

Clear page structure, user-friendly URLs, and proper internal linking enhance both user navigation and search engine crawling, making your site more effective and easier to rank.

How to Naturally Integrate Keywords

Primary keywords should be placed in headings, the first paragraphs, and meta tags. Additional keywords should be evenly distributed throughout the text to maintain natural flow and avoid keyword stuffing.

 

Building an Effective Link-Building Strategy

 

How to Acquire High-Quality Backlinks

Here are proven methods for earning backlinks without large budgets:

  • Participating in industry portal interviews;

  • Publishing guest posts on relevant blogs;

  • Creating unique, shareable content that attracts natural links.

 

Guest Posts and Local Directories

Guest posting and listing your business in local directories help strengthen your website’s authority and expand your backlink profile.
